Volunteering to tutor students is not usually getting out of your comfort zone. Usually, non clinical volunteering is meant to show that you have dedicated time to helping those less fortunate (ie homeless shelter, food bank, soup kitchen). I would encourage you to try to gain more experience along those lines. You may have to take out service focused schools such as Oakland and Loyola because of that, regardless of MCAT.

Also, UCR and UCD take students near their geographical area. So if you live in the Inland Empire and are applying to UCR, you probably should not apply to UCD as it is on the opposite side of the state. Vice versa, if you are in Sacramento, central CA or some part of Northern California, apply to Davis but not UCR.
